Parent PLUS

Quick Links: Direct Parent PLUS Loan MPN (MPN required for first time Direct Loan PLUS borrowers only)
                    Information on Direct loans for parents

Lender: U.S. Department of Education
Eligibility requirements: Dependent undergraduate student must file a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A). Borrower must be a parent or guardian of a dependent undergraduate student enrolled at least half time (6 credits), making satisfactory academic progress. Credit check required, eligibility is not guaranteed.

Process:

  1. PLUS Request: Required annually; completed at www.studentloans.gov.
    • Request includes loan amount options: Maximum (allows awarding to cover direct charges not covered by other aid) and specific loan request amounts.
    • If parent borrower is not approved the student may be awarded additional Unsubsidized Stafford loan: $4000 FR/SO $5000 JR/SR.
    • Revisions to your initial request may be made by contacting SFS.
  2. DL PLUS MPN: Completed at www.studentloans.gov. MPN is borrower and dependent student specific. A second MPN will be required if the previous MPN required an endorser or has otherwise become inactive. A parent PLUS MPN is required for each dependent student.

Interest accrual begins: when funds are disbursed
Repayment begins: 60 days after the last scheduled disbursement
